Output b71577d6c65d5d5a597f838c7f626de92d78fe1639b0a278ff99f0b1261e3873:0

value
13753957
script pubkey
OP_HASH160 OP_PUSHBYTES_20 afcf1423a27be5aeb25039467c0179da21a88846 OP_EQUAL
address
3HicFC6tN43U5ff95U4tV1xWeex2Rqwq9d
transaction
b71577d6c65d5d5a597f838c7f626de92d78fe1639b0a278ff99f0b1261e3873
confirmations
530886
spent
true